Your first steps before leveraging Objective-C to send an electronic signature in our Hub:
- Get started. Select Talk to an expert on the main page to get help utilizing Objective-C to send an electronic signature
- Follow the setup instructions. Open your email with the setup steps and follow them to sign up and access your testing API environment.
- Add your first application. Click the Add app button, provide its name and link, and the Client and Secret ID will be generated automatically.
- Choose your go-to grant type. Options include Code Grant, JWT, Implicit, and Password Grant. Check out the description of each before making a selection.
- Obtain your authorization code. Copy the provided link, then open it in a new browser tab.
- Set up your organization. Add a new organization and invite users to join it.
- Prepare documents for completion. Create a DOCX file with tags for fillable fields, set up a template, and upload your document to a template and pre-fill it with the needed data.
- Finalize the process. Share your pre-populated DOCX with recipients, get notified of any changes applied, and download the completed copy.
